What this record means
The record shows that the mark “XBOX TECHNOLOGIES” is dead, having been abandoned by its owner, XBOX Technologies, Inc., a corporation organized in Minnesota. The mark was filed on May 2 2000 under an intent‑to‑use basis for services in class 041, specifically “Providing a wide area of information in the fields of entertainment, hospitality, travel, music or movies or sports over global computer networks, global communication networks, wireless devices, telephone and desk top computers.” Because the mark is no longer active, it does not give the owner control over every use of the wording, but it does create a closer concern for any similar name used in the same or closely related services. The prosecution history shows a non‑final action in March 2001 and an express abandonment mailed on August 9 2001, with no further enforcement activity recorded. The supplied history contains no visible opposition or cancellation events. For someone considering a similar name, the abandoned status reduces the risk, yet the specific services listed remain a potential point of concern.
